
Buddy Matthews gives Rhea Ripley a new nickname after her loss at WrestleMania 41; has an immediate reaction
Buddy Matthews has reacted after Rhea Ripley's match at WrestleMania 41. The Eradicator's husband gave her a new nickname after her incredible effort against Iyo Sky and Bianca Belair.
Ripley, Belair, and Sky went back and forth in the opening match of Night 2 of WrestleMania 41. Sky walked in as the champion and successfully retained her title after pinning Belair. During the match's closing moments, Sky hit her signature moonsault from the top rope after Belair hit the K.O.D. on Ripley.
On X, Matthews called Rhea Ripley "Mrs. WrestleMania" after her valiant performance in the Triple Threat Women's World Championship match.
"@RheaRipley_WWE is MRS. WRESTLEMANIA!" wrote Matthews.

Weeks before WrestleMania 41, Rhea Ripley lost the WWE Women's World Championship to Iyo Sky. She had earned herself a rematch for the title with Bianca Belair as the special guest referee. Unfortunately for The Eradicator, she was unsuccessful in regaining the title on Monday night and found herself in a Triple Threat situation on The Grandest Stage of Them All.
Despite the loss for Ripley, she wasn't pinned in the outcome of the contest and could challenge for the title once again. WWE's plans for Ripley could be revealed on the upcoming edition of Monday Night RAW.
